Output 93b0af5a5086094a351142d5fa222003f9fd801ac58ed74ddc232cbaeb733fb8:0

value
316005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9da1d35d3e01839ed39730039e6413e1e6dfaca OP_EQUAL
address
3JdiDsBBSRU39cJzqPLCsB2eC4TsUdmLL4
transaction
93b0af5a5086094a351142d5fa222003f9fd801ac58ed74ddc232cbaeb733fb8
spent
true